Catalog description

This course explores the fundamentals and tools of managing projects and project activity where a project requires commitment of several types of resources. The project management elements of planning, scheduling, and control address the major elements that comprise this function. The elements in conjunction with the tools and techniques of project management such as the critical path method (CPM), program evaluation and review technique (PERT) and a commercial project management software are explored in depth. This knowledge is essential to those who manage any major supply chain or logistics projects. This course is cross listed with MGMT 340.
